Help me find a farm ! by [deleted] in Hamilton

[–]spitzzy 0 points1 point  (0 children)

Cheese Shop just outside Hamilton/Stoney creek: https://www.paroncheese.com

Maple Syrup, there’s a farm on Guyatt Rd. Binbrook between Fletcher and Hwy 56 with a big sign out front for Maple Syrup

Raw Honey, Guyatt Rd. also has a a house near the Fletcher intersection selling this - they also have a sign.

Binbrook has lots of farms with markets. Lincoln Line Orchards is open year round and right near the cheese place I mentioned. They sell a lot of this stuff too plus their apples. I’m pretty sure I’ve seen farm eggs there too.

got rejected in less than a day by torpydo in starbucks

[–]spitzzy 0 points1 point  (0 children)

I’m thinking it’s because all your job experience has zero to do with the food industry. You currently work a very routine job whereas Starbucks would be fast paced retail and you don’t have any pos experience on your resume. I would think you aren’t the only one applying and if someone has one of the things I listed their resume already looks a bit more related to the job.

I think putting a cover letter explaining a bit of your situation/why you want to shift in industries it could help. Focus on wanting to broaden your experiences and grow your skill set in the work force. Or that you want a job that can leave a positive impression on a larger customer base. Write your resume for the job you want not the one you have.

[deleted by user] by [deleted] in foodbutforbabies

[–]spitzzy 2 points3 points  (0 children)

Substitute the sweet potato with the same amount of squash - I recommend butternut or acorn. I also have a picky 2yo when it comes to meat/protein - we make pb and j oatmeal with pb mixed in while cooking, I add frozen raspberries and flaxseeds at the end and stir. This helps with his constipation and cools it down to eat basically right away.

For meat I’ve been able to get away with the tummy toddler food hidden veggie meatballs, I add whatever veg I have on hand super chopped up. Usually kale and carrot. After cooking chop the meatball up into whatever sauce your LO will eat it in - even better a puree veg one

[deleted by user] by [deleted] in foodbutforbabies

[–]spitzzy 5 points6 points  (0 children)

Yummy toddler food has a bunch of hidden veggie meals/sauces. Just google hidden veggie versions of what you know they’ll eat. I’ve found some good Mac and cheese ones with blended cauliflower and butternut squash in the cheese sauce. If you can get away with adding hemp hearts to things that would help with nutrients a little bit as well. Peanut butter is good for protein you can use apples as the transportation. Hummus could be a good idea to look into trying too
